Strategies for Improving Your Cricket Batting Skills

Cricket is a team sport requiring batting, bowling, and fielding proficiency. Among these, batting is frequently regarded as one of the game’s trickiest and most essential components. A good hitter may swing a game in his team’s favor; therefore, budding cricketers must concentrate on honing their batting techniques. This post will cover various designs for improving your cricket batting abilities.

Improve Your Grip and Stance 

The proper posture and grip form the basis of each successful batter’s game. With the feet shoulder-width apart, the knees slightly bent, and the weight equally distributed on both feet, the ideal posture should be balanced. The upper hand (left for a right-handed batter and vice versa for a left-handed batsman) controls the direction of the shot, and the grip should be solid but not too tight. You must practice and maintain a proper posture and grip to improve as a batter.

Put Footwork: Batting requires a lot of footwork. Adjusting to the ball’s line and length requires getting into the proper position and performing precise movements. Regular footwork exercises, like defensive shots forward and backward, can help you position yourself more effectively to play the ball. Paying attention to your footwork will help you maintain your balance and move quickly between shots.

Learn the Foundations: Cricket is frequently called a game of inches, so learning the fundamentals is crucial. Focus on playing compact, straight shots when defending or attacking the ball. It entails using the entire bat face and keeping your gaze fixed on the ball. To build a solid foundation, consistently practice the straight drive, front defense, and backfoot defense.

Exercise Against a Variety of Bowling 

You need to be able to manage various bowling styles if you want to develop into a complete batter. Practice against spinners, seamers, and quick bowlers to increase your adaptability. Reading the bowler’s hand and predicting the delivery style can offer you a significant advantage. Your shot selection and decision-making skills will improve as you encounter different bowling styles.

Construct Shot Selection: The ability of a batter to select the appropriate shot for each delivery is a talent that sets great batters apart from average ones. Work on choosing your photos depending on the field placements, the bowler’s line and length, and the pitch conditions. You can make wiser selections and execute your strokes skillfully if you know your batter’s strengths and shortcomings.

Enhance the Placement and Timing: The secret to routinely scoring runs is timing and positioning. Practice hitting the ball late and under your eyes to enhance your timing. Improve your placement by attempting to identify fielding gaps and avoiding fielders. Your chances of scoring runs will increase, and your probability of being caught will decrease if you hit the ball into the holes.

Mental Fortitude and Attention

Mental Fortitude and Attention

Cricket is a game that requires both physical and mental skill. You can develop mental toughness by maintaining your composure and attention at the crease. To keep your focus during extended innings, try meditation or visualization techniques. A decent and brilliant inning can frequently be distinguished by mental toughness.

Playing in a Variety of Situations Gaining experience in numerous situations is essential to developing into a well-rounded batter. It involves adapting to various weather conditions, playing on different fields, and facing multiple ball varieties (red, white, and pink). Your ability to manage any situation in a game will improve with more exposure to various cricketing conditions.

Look for Qualified Coaching

Working with a qualified coach can significantly accelerate your progress as a batter. A coach can pinpoint and correct technical problems, provide individualized guidance, and set up systematic training plans to address specific weaknesses. Feel free to spend money on high-quality coaching to advance your batting abilities.

Examine and Analyze Review your performance in games and practice sessions regularly. Keep a log of your innings, highlighting your accomplishments and areas for development. Use video analysis to identify technical issues so that you can fix them. For long-term advancement, self-evaluation and constant growth are essential.
